Code Review – co daje inspekcja kodu i jak ją przeprowadzać?

Code Review to jedna z kluczowych, choć wciąż marginalizowanych, praktyk programistycznych. Nazywana też inspekcją lub przeglądem kodu, polega na jego ocenie przez recenzenta  przed wypuszczeniem do systemu kontroli wersji i dalszym testowaniem. Dlaczego warto wdrożyć w firmie oceny kodu nawet mimo wiszących nad głową deadline`ów? Poniżej 4 kluczowe korzyści  ze stosowania Code Review. Usunięcie błędów

Czy programista powinien się specjalizować w określonej dziedzinie?

Ekspercka wiedza w określonej dziedzinie, czy też wszechstronność specjalizacji? Mówi się, że jeśli jest się specjalistą od wszystkiego, to tak naprawdę od niczego. Ile w tym prawdy w przypadku branży IT? Początki wcale nie muszą być trudne Droga wydaje się prosta już na samym początku. Nie można od razu umieć wszystkiego, trzeba działać metodą małych

6 cech idealnego Project Managera, czyli o czym marzą developerzy?

Kufel zimnego piwa w ciepły wieczór po całym dniu pracy? Ekskluzywne wakacje? Szybki, sportowy samochód? Pełne konto w banku? Z pewnością każdy lub prawie każdy marzył chociażby o jednej z powyżej wymienionych rzeczy. O czym jeszcze marzymy, a może nawet nie mamy odwagi marzyć? Możliwe, że dla niektórych jest to satysfakcja z pracy, poczucie, że

Telefoniczna rozmowa rekrutacyjna: jak się do niej przygotować?

Telefoniczna rozmowa rekrutacyjna jest równie ważna jak spotkanie w cztery oczy z rekruterem, nie należy więc jej lekceważyć. Zwykle firmy stosują taką formę wywiadu, aby dowiedzieć się, czy kandydat nadal jest zainteresowany pracą i czy jego umiejętności pokrywają się z kwalifikacjami potrzebnymi na dane stanowisko. To również spora oszczędność czasu. Wiele osób uważa, że rozmowa